Output d73069252754ae548a2620983e0ece9f370cb21d3fe95546ec3b914006c6641b:23

value
159411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12373d961594e9f8301897bdcd5a4bab301ff82a OP_EQUAL
address
33MLGBL2eUCC93Ji5WW8YtSzuZbRJiR6XW
transaction
d73069252754ae548a2620983e0ece9f370cb21d3fe95546ec3b914006c6641b
spent
true